1833 Spain Proclamation Coin - please help with PCGS code

I have an 1833 Spain Isabel II coin issued to proclaim Isabel II as rightful heir to the throne. It can be found in the Cayon book as # 16789. It is 1 Real sized (15mm diameter) silver with 1/2 Real value. Please see pictures below.

In order to submit to PCGS for holdering I need to find a KM# or PCGS code to identify it to PCGS. However, I have been unable to find this in Krause book, Numismaster (Krause online), or in the PCGS auto search listing tool. Maybe its listed in a way I have not considered? Any tips would be appreciated. I'll take whatever I learn here and approach PCGS directly to see if they can holder it. PCGS appears to have codes for all the other Spain Isabel coins I submit. I am hoping they can do this one as well.

Any thoughts or ideas you could provide would be much appreciated. Thanks!
